What Is a Corporate Lock Screen?
A corporate lock screen appears before an employee logs into their computer and again when they return to an idle device. This makes it one of the most visible places to display important but non-urgent information.
Because employees naturally see it multiple times during the day, it works well as a complementary channel alongside desktop alerts, email, mobile, and other internal communication tools.

Ways to Use Lock Screen Messages for Internal Communications
This channel works best for important, non-urgent messages that benefit from repeated visibility during the day.
Company News
Share updates in a visually engaging way using high-quality imagery to highlight achievements, goals, KPI progress, or important projects.
Change Communications
Increase awareness of change initiatives, reinforce key messages, and help staff adapt to new processes or organizational direction.
Incident Communications
Use lock screens as part of a flood-all-channels approach during critical incidents to improve awareness and visibility.
Event Reminders
Promote upcoming training, product launches, social activities, or internal events and remind employees they are approaching.
Behavioral Change
Reinforce expectations around safety, ethics, compliance, wellness, and workplace etiquette through repeated visual reminders.
Countdown Clocks
Build anticipation around launches, campaigns, or major announcements by updating lock screen creatives with daily countdown visuals.
